Ingredients
ENRICHED WHEAT FLOUR (WHEAT FLOUR, NIACIN, REDUCED IRON, THIAMIN MONONITRATE, RIBOFLAVIN, FOLIC ACID), SUNFLOWER OIL AND/OR CANOLA OIL, SEA SALT, WHOLE WHEAT FLOUR, AND LESS THAN 2% OF THE FOLLOWING: ORGANIC CANE SUGAR, OAT BRAN, YEAST, MALTED BARLEY FLOUR, ASCORBIC ACID (ANTIOXIDANT), AND ROSEMARY EXTRACT (ANTIOXIDANT). CONTAINS WHEAT INGREDIENTS.
What is a Dairy Free diet?
A dairy-free diet eliminates all foods made from or containing milk and milk-derived ingredients, such as butter, cheese, yogurt, and cream. It's essential for people with lactose intolerance, milk allergies, or those who prefer plant-based alternatives. Common dairy substitutes include almond, soy, oat, and coconut-based milks and cheeses. While dairy is a major source of calcium and vitamin D, these nutrients can be replaced through fortified foods or supplements. Many people find going dairy-free helps reduce digestive issues, acne, or inflammation, but balance and proper nutrient intake remain key for long-term health.
